diff options
Diffstat (limited to 'python/pykde/sip/kdefx/kstyle.sip')
-rw-r--r-- | python/pykde/sip/kdefx/kstyle.sip | 126 |
1 files changed, 0 insertions, 126 deletions
diff --git a/python/pykde/sip/kdefx/kstyle.sip b/python/pykde/sip/kdefx/kstyle.sip deleted file mode 100644 index 42ee3787..00000000 --- a/python/pykde/sip/kdefx/kstyle.sip +++ /dev/null @@ -1,126 +0,0 @@ -// -// Copyright 2006 Jim Bublitz <jbublitz@nwinternet.com> -// Earlier copyrights 1998 - 2005 Jim Bublitz and/or Phil Thompson -// may also apply - - -// Generated by preSip -// module kdefx version KDE 3.5.3 - - -// This software is free software; you can redistribute it and/or -// modify it under the terms of the GNU General Public License as -// published by the Free Software Foundation; either version 2 of -// the License, or (at your option) any later version. -// -// This software is distributed in the hope that it will be useful, -// but WITHOUT ANY WARRANTY; without even the implied warranty of -// M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-// GNU General Public License for more details. -// -// You should have received a copy of the GNU General Public -// License along with this library; see the file COPYING. -// If not, write to the Free Software Foundation, Inc., -// 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. - - -class KStyle : QCommonStyle -{ -%TypeHeaderCode -#include <kstyle.h> -%End - - -public: - typedef uint KStyleFlags; - - enum KStyleOption - { - Default, - AllowMenuTransparency, - FilledFrameWorkaround - }; - - - enum KStyleScrollBarType - { - WindowsStyleScrollBar, - PlatinumStyleScrollBar, - ThreeButtonScrollBar, - NextStyleScrollBar - }; - - KStyle (KStyle::KStyleFlags = KStyle ::Default , KStyle::KStyleScrollBarType = KStyle ::WindowsStyleScrollBar ); - -%If ( KDE_3_1_0 - ) - static QString defaultStyle (); -%End - - void setScrollBarType (KStyle::KStyleScrollBarType); - KStyle::KStyleFlags styleFlags () const; - virtual void renderMenuBlendPixmap (KPixmap&, const QColorGroup&, const QPopupMenu*) const; - - enum KStylePrimitive - { - KPE_DockWindowHandle, - KPE_ToolBarHandle, - KPE_GeneralHandle, - KPE_SliderGroove, - KPE_SliderHandle, - KPE_ListViewExpander, - KPE_ListViewBranch - }; - - virtual void drawKStylePrimitive (KStyle::KStylePrimitive, QPainter*, const QWidget*, const QRect&, const QColorGroup&, SFlags = Style_Default , const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- - enum KStylePixelMetric - { - KPM_MenuItemSeparatorHeight, - KPM_MenuItemHMargin, - KPM_MenuItemVMargin, - KPM_MenuItemHFrame, - KPM_MenuItemVFrame, - KPM_MenuItemCheckMarkHMargin, - KPM_MenuItemArrowHMargin, - KPM_MenuItemTabSpacing, - KPM_ListViewBranchThickness - }; - - int kPixelMetric (KStyle::KStylePixelMetric, const QWidget* = 0) const; - void polish (QWidget*); - void unPolish (QWidget*); - void polishPopupMenu (QPopupMenu*); - void drawPrimitive (PrimitiveElement, QPainter*, const QRect&, const QColorGroup&, SFlags = Style_Default , const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- void drawControl (ControlElement, QPainter*, const QWidget*, const QRect&, const QColorGroup&, SFlags = Style_Default , const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- void drawComplexControl (ComplexControl, QPainter*, const QWidget*, const QRect&, const QColorGroup&, SFlags = Style_Default , SCFlags = SC_All , SCFlags = SC_None , const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- SubControl querySubControl (ComplexControl, const QWidget*, const QPoint&, const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- QRect querySubControlMetrics (ComplexControl, const QWidget*, SubControl, const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- int pixelMetric (PixelMetric, const QWidget* = 0) const; - QRect subRect (SubRect, const QWidget*) const; - QPixmap stylePixmap (StylePixmap, const QWidget* = 0, const QStyleOption& = QStyleOption (QStyleOption ::Default )) const; - int styleHint (StyleHint, const QWidget* = 0, const QStyleOption& = QStyleOption (QStyleOption ::Default ), QStyleHintReturn* = 0) const; - -protected: - bool eventFilter (QObject*, QEvent*); - -private: - KStyle (const KStyle&); - -protected: -//igx virtual void virtual_hook (int, void*); - -//force -%ConvertToSubClassCode - // The table of Python class objects indexed by their names. The table - // must be sorted by name. - - static sipStringTypeClassMap map[] = { - {sipName_KStyle, &sipClass_KStyle}, - }; - - sipClass = sipMapStringToClass(sipCpp -> className(),map,sizeof (map)/sizeof (map[0])); -%End -//end - -}; // class KStyle - |